The 30-year-old once denied USTA funding returned to Arthur Ashe Stadium to complete her career doubles grand slam alongside Kateřina Siniaková The cheers swelled from Arthur Ashe Stadium as Taylor Townsend approached the microphone on court. “Y’all know this is my moment,” she started, “and I’m about to take it.” A day after being denied an American rooting interest in the women’s singles final and rushing for the exits in response, the Ashe crowd had reason to stick around and drink in the moment: the Chicago native and her partner, Kateřina Siniaková of the Czech Republic, had just defeated the all-American team of Ashlyn Krueger and Robin Montgomery 5-7, 6-0, 6-2 in Friday’s women’s doubles final. With the victory, Siniaková became a two-time career doubles slam champion while Townsend joined the club for the first time. Continue reading...
